G.M. Collin City D-Tox Serum is a product with 57 ingredients. Contains: AHA - Citric Acid; Vitamins - Niacinamide, Tocopheryl Acetate; Antioxidant - Niacinamide, Hydroxyacetophenone, Pyrus Malus (Apple) Fruit Extract, Tocopheryl Acetate, Tocopherol, Lecithin, Carrageenan, Citric Acid;

Organic score: 25% natural, 53% chemical. Vegan - No; Cruelty free - No; Reef safe - Yes;

Glycerin is one of the most outstanding and helpful skincare components. It's used in many skincare products because it works and provides notable results. It's one of the best moisturizers. Molecules of Glycerin can absorb water and deliver it into deep layers of the skin making it hydrated.

Niacinamide is a form of Vitamin B3 and it’s a superman in cosmetics. This ingredient is researched very well. It has a lot of positive reviews from scientists and experts. It's very important for healthy skin. The lack of this vitamin can cause dryness, itching, and sun sensitivity. The component removes small wrinkles and fine lines, heals wounds, and prevents the forming of cancer cells. It also makes the skin tone even by removing dark spots. It increases ceramide synthesis which increases the overall health of your skin. It fights acne and lowers pores.

Researches say that 4-5% of Niacinamide is the most effective concentration for skincare use.

1,2-Hexanediol can do a lot of good things for the formulation of the product. It’s an emollient, preservative, and humectant. It keeps skin hydrated and soft. It’s a good component for dry and dehydrated skin.
